Answer:if your lookin for what p = then here
Step-by-step explanation:
10p−14=9p+17
Subtract 9p from both sides.
10p−14−9p=17
Combine 10p and −9p to get p.
p−14=17
Add 14 to both sides.
p=17+14
Add 17 and 14 to get 31.
p=31
